PROBLEM TO BE SOLVED: To provide a spread spectrum communication method which eliminates interference between channels without superposing a direct current on a spread code while using a troublesome DC superposing circuit. SOLUTION: Signals Sg1 to Sgi are applied to gates G1 to Gi. The gates G1 to Gi allow the signals Sg1 to Sgi to pass according to a normal modulation code applied from a modulation code generator 18. The signals from the gates G1 to Gi are added by an adding circuit 10 and applied to a multiplying circuit 12. A signal received through an antenna 31, on the other hand, is inputted to a 3rd multiplying circuit 48 through a 2nd multiplying circuit 41. The 3rd multiplying circuit 48 multiplies signals inputted in unbiased normal modulation code from a modulation code generator 26. The signal from the 3rd multiplying circuit 48 is integrated by an integrator 50 and demodulated into source signals Sg1 to Sgi. |
